Is this the way the blink counter is supposed to work?
 
I have an LED (let's say permanently) hooked up to the diagnostic port (which has no cover on it) on the left fenderwell. I have never been able to get any blinks out of it since I installed it about a year ago. But If I disconnect the TPS, the LED comes on, and stays on, without blinking. It turns back off when the TPS is reconnected. Is this what is supposed to happen? The KLR chip that I am running is the one that comes with the APE MAF setup. Would that make any difference?
